Choosing the right gutter material is essential for ensuring durability and minimizing maintenance. Different materials offer varying lifespans, costs, and aesthetic options. Understanding these factors helps buyers make informed decisions for their homes.
Common Gutter Materials
Several materials are popular for gutters, each with unique characteristics. The most common options include aluminum, vinyl, steel, and copper. Each material varies in cost, appearance, and resistance to weather conditions.
Longevity of Gutter Materials
The lifespan of gutters depends on the material used and maintenance practices. Aluminum gutters typically last 20 to 30 years, while vinyl gutters may last 10 to 20 years. Steel gutters can last 20 to 25 years if properly maintained, and copper gutters often exceed 50 years.
Factors Affecting Gutter Longevity
- Climate: Exposure to harsh weather can accelerate wear.
- Maintenance: Regular cleaning prevents clogs and corrosion.
- Installation: Proper installation reduces damage and leaks.
- Material Quality: Higher-quality materials tend to last longer.
